Marksville took a six-run defeat the last time they faced off against Florien, but this time they managed to keep it close and that made all the difference. The Tigers came out on top in a nail-biter against the Blackcats on Monday, sneaking past 4-3. The victory made it back-to-back wins for the Tigers.
Marksville's record is now 6-18. As for Florien, they are on a ten-game losing streak that has dropped them down to 7-19.
Both squads will have to hit the road in their upcoming contests. Marksville will head out to face off against Vidalia at 5:00 p.m. on Tuesday. This will be the Tigers' first chance to prove their worth in the conference. As for Florien, they will head out on the road to challenge Brusly at 5:00 p.m. on Tuesday. The Blackcats will need to watch out since the Panthers have now posted at least ten runs in their last three matchups.
